Output 23c54e6aa0c268e1dc9d801dd435597908fc15a42f16345617af6e5c03dd393a:0

value
44331
script pubkey
OP_0 OP_PUSHBYTES_20 51f3316c6b40c5a021113aff8a09a034d66850d3
address
bc1q28enzmrtgrz6qgg38tlc5zdqxntxs5xn5je6xj
transaction
23c54e6aa0c268e1dc9d801dd435597908fc15a42f16345617af6e5c03dd393a
confirmations
52109
spent
true